"""Tests for pylint.checkers.exceptions.""" import sys import unittest from astroid import test_utils from pylint.checkers import exceptions from pylint.testutils import CheckerTestCase, Message class ExceptionsCheckerTest(CheckerTestCase): """Tests for pylint.checkers.exceptions.""" CHECKER_CLASS = exceptions.ExceptionsChecker # These tests aren't in the functional test suite, # since they will be converted with 2to3 for Python 3 # and `raise (Error, ...)` will be converted to # `raise Error(...)`, so it beats the purpose of the test. @unittest.skipUnless(sys.version_info[0] == 3, "The test should emit an error on Python 3.") def test_raising_bad_type_python3(self): node = test_utils.extract_node('raise (ZeroDivisionError, None) #@') message = Message('raising-bad-type', node=node, args='tuple') with self.assertAddsMessages(message): self.checker.visit_raise(node) @unittest.skipUnless(sys.version_info[0] == 2, "The test is valid only on Python 2.") def test_raising_bad_type_python2(self): nodes = test_utils.extract_node(''' raise (ZeroDivisionError, None) #@ from something import something raise (something, None) #@ raise (4, None) #@ raise () #@ ''') with self.assertNoMessages(): self.checker.visit_raise(nodes[0]) with self.assertNoMessages(): self.checker.visit_raise(nodes[1]) message = Message('raising-bad-type', node=nodes[2], args='tuple') with self.assertAddsMessages(message): self.checker.visit_raise(nodes[2]) message = Message('raising-bad-type', node=nodes[3], args='tuple') with self.assertAddsMessages(message): self.checker.visit_raise(nodes[3]) if __name__ == '__main__': unittest.main()
